Song of Songs 8:1-2
Christian Standard Bible
8 If only I could treat you like my brother,[a]
one who nursed at my mother’s breasts,
I would find you in public and kiss you,
and no one would scorn me.
2 I would lead you, I would take you,
to the house of my mother(A) who taught me.[b]
I would give you spiced wine to drink
from the juice of my pomegranate.
Song of Solomon 8:1-2
International Standard Version
8 If only you were like a brother to me,
like[a] one who nursed at my mother’s breasts.
If I found you outside I would kiss you,
and no one would view me with contempt.[b]
2 I would lead you,
I would bring you
to the house of my mother
who used to teach me.
I would give you some spiced wine to drink,
from the juice of my pomegranates.[c]
Footnotes
- Song of Solomon 8:1 The Heb. lacks like
- Song of Solomon 8:1 I.e. think badly of me
- Song of Solomon 8:2 Or some of my sweet pomegranate wine
